To solve the conventional problem that direct reaction between metal and carbon fiber in a metal-matrix carbon-fiber-reinforced composite material causes the deterioration of the carbon fiber and the expected characteristics, such as strength, Young's modulus, high thermal conductivity and low thermal expansion, cannot be exhibited and to find the various characteristics of the metal-matrix carbon-fiber-reinforced composite material and to provide the material having excellent weatherability and heat resistance by suppressing the above reaction.
In manufacturing the carbon-fiber compact, an organic precursor which remains in the form of carbon on firing in a nonoxidizing atmosphere is used as a binder so that the resultant residual carbon can be interposed later between the molten metal and the carbon fiber to prevent the direct reaction. Deterioration in strength of the carbon fiber can be prevented. In the method for manufacturing the metal-matrix carbon-fiber-reinforced composite material, composing with the metal is performed by pressing the molten metal into the carbon compact under high pressure.
